Safety
Many are worried about the safety of bunk beds, but a recent study suggests that this type of bed isn't as risky as many believe. Statistics indicate that falls are the cause of many injuries, but the majority of them aren't enough serious to warrant immediate medical attention.
If your children are using bunk beds, make sure to inform them about safety rules to ensure they are able to use it safely and avoid injury. Some of the most frequent injuries that happen to children in bunk beds are cuts, bumps, bruises and broken bones.
The most important bunk safety tip for bed is to ensure that the top bunk is equipped with guardrails. The rails must rise at least 5 inches above the mattress, https://d3x.ch with an opening of not more than 15 inches. They should also be secured to the bed using bolts that must be released before they can be removed. The tops of the rails should not be less than five inches above the mattress foundation.
Another important bunk bed safety tip is making sure there aren't any gaps or openings that could cause small children to get trapped or fall into. This can be as simple and simple as holes on the top, sides or the bottom of the bed. Or as complex as a gap between the two walls.
